2/x-1 = 3/x+2 . The answer is is 7 however I do not understand how they got this answer >:(

The answer could be 7. 2/(x-1) = 3/(x+2), x = 7. (2/x)-1 = (3/x)+2, x = -1/3.

for 2/(x-1) = 3/(x+2): cross multiply: 2(x+2) = 3(x-1) expand terms: 2x + 4 = 3x -3 add -3x -4 to both sides: -x = -7 divide by -1: x = 7
